Transaction 8566162c75082319f52f97892253396e78a980e7ef7d81d65c82c8f746af1711
1 Input
2 Outputs
- 8566162c75082319f52f97892253396e78a980e7ef7d81d65c82c8f746af1711:0
- 8566162c75082319f52f97892253396e78a980e7ef7d81d65c82c8f746af1711:1
value 156632
address 2N8hwP1WmJrFF5QWABn38y63uYLhnJYJYTF
value 64833368
address mvRA1qemEdkUCk9w79CpmYgzuqnGpFm2Fk